Abstract :
We introduce a computationally simple video compression algorithm based on Y. Chiu and T. Berger´s (1999) CU30 algorithm, suitable for video streaming and telephony. The authors concentrate on being able to identify and select regions in the difference frame domain in order that only the regions deemed important for quality and rate are chosen and encoded. A binary shape coder is designed to describe the shape of the regions selected. We propose a method of evaluating any binary shape coder by simulating shapes using a two dimensional random field generator, calculating the field´s entropy rate, and comparing it to the rate of the encoder
